OBJECTIVE: Triple-negative breast cancer (TNBC) is an aggressive subtype with a poor prognosis. Minichromosome maintenance genes (MCM2-7) crucial for DNA replication are significant biomarkers for various tumor types; however, their roles in TNBC remain underexplored. MATERIALS AND METHODS: We utilized four TNBC-related GEO databases to examine MCM2-7 gene expression and predict its prognosis in TNBC, performing single-cell analysis and GSEA to discover MCM6's potential function. The Cancer Dependency Map gene effect scores and CCK8 assay were used to assess MCM6's impact on TNBC cell proliferation. The correlations between MCM6 expression, immune infiltrates, and immune cells were also analyzed. WGCNA and LASSO Cox regression built a risk score model predicting TNBC patient survival based on MCM6-related gene expression. RESULTS: MCM2-7 gene expression was higher in TNBC tissues compared to adjacent normal tissues. High MCM6 expression correlated with shorter TNBC patient survival time. GSEA and single-cell analysis revealed a relationship between elevated MCM6 expression and the cell cycle pathway. MCM6 knockdown inhibited TNBC cell proliferation. A risk model featuring MCM6, CDC23, and CCNB1 effectively predicts TNBC patient survival. CONCLUSIONS: MCM6 overexpression in TNBC links to a worse prognosis and reduced cell proliferation upon MCM6 knockdown. We developed a risk score model based on MCM6-related genes predicting TNBC patient prognosis, potentially assisting future treatment strategies.

The Sunong black pig is a new composite breed under development generated from Chinese indigenous pig breeds (i.e., Taihu and Huai) and intensive pig breeds (i.e., Landrace and Berkshire), which is an important genetic material for studying breeding mechanisms. However, there is currently limited knowledge about the genetic structure and germplasm characteristics of Sunong black pigs. To comprehensively understand their genetic composition and ancestry proportions, we performed population structure and local ancestry inference analysis based on whole-genome sequencing information. The results showed that Sunong black pigs could be clustered independently into a group, whose pedigree was intermediate between indigenous and commercial pig breeds, but closer to commercial pigs. Furthermore, local ancestry inference analysis revealed that Sunong black pigs inherited immune and reproductive traits from indigenous pig breeds, including CC and CXC chemokine family, Toll-like receptor family, IFN gene family, ESR1, AREG and EREG gene, while growth and development-related traits were inherited from commercial pig breeds, including IGF1 and GSY2 gene. Overall, Sunong black pigs have formed a relatively stable genome structure with some advantageous traits inherited from their ancestral breeds. This study deepened the understanding of the breeding mechanism of Sunong black pigs and provided a reference for cross-breeding programmes in livestock.

Heat stress is a major problem that constrains pig productivity. Understanding and identifying adaptation to heat stress has been the focus of recent studies, and the identification of genome-wide selection signatures can provide insights into the mechanisms of environmental adaptation. Here, we generated whole-genome re-sequencing data from six Chinese indigenous pig populations to identify genomic regions with selection signatures related to heat tolerance using multiple methods: three methods for intra-population analyses (Integrated Haplotype Score, Runs of Homozygosity and Nucleotide diversity Analysis) and three methods for inter-population analyses (Fixation index (FST), Cross-population Composite Likelihood Ratio and Cross-population Extended Haplotype Homozygosity). In total, 1 966 796 single nucleotide polymorphisms were identified in this study. Genetic structure analyses and FST indicated differentiation among these breeds. Based on information on the location environment, the six breeds were divided into heat and cold groups. By combining two or more approaches for selection signatures, outlier signals in overlapping regions were identified as candidate selection regions. A total of 163 candidate genes were identified, of which, 29 were associated with heat stress injury and anti-inflammatory effects. These candidate genes were further associated with 78 Gene Ontology functional terms and 30 Kyoto Encyclopedia of Genes and Genomes pathways in enrichment analysis (P < 0.05). Some of these have clear relevance to heat resistance, such as the AMPK signalling pathway and the mTOR signalling pathway. The results improve our understanding of the selection mechanisms responsible for heat resistance in pigs and provide new insights of introgression in heat adaptation.

Objective: To observe the clinical efficacy of spinal cord stimulation (SCS) in the treatment of diabetic foot (DF). Methods: Sixteen patients who were diagnosed with DF and treated with SCS from the Department of Pain Medicine of the First Affiliated Hospital, China Medical University from October 2015 to October 2018 were retrospectively analyzed. Visual analogue scale (VAS), 36-item short form health survey (SF-36), transcutaneous oxygen partial pressure (TcPO2) and skin temperature of lower limbs were compared before and after treatment, and the complications were recorded. Results: Among the 16 patients, 14 were equipped with implantable pulse generator (IPG). The VAS scores decreased significantly from 7.5±1.2 before treatment to 2.6±0.8, 2.0±0.7, 1.6±0.6, 1.0±0.9, 0.9±0.9 at 1 day, 1 week, 3 months, 6 months and 12 months after electrode implantation respectively (all P<0.05). At 12 months after treatment, the parameters of SF-36 were significantly different from those before treatment (all P<0.05). The TcPO2 was (23±5) mmHg before treatment and (38±6) mmHg at 1 week after treatment, with a statistical difference (P<0.05), and the temperature of lower limbs increased significantly (P<0.05). No serious complications were observed in all patients. Conclusion: SCS can relieve the pain of patients with DF, improve the microcirculation and blood supply of lower limbs, and thus promote the quality of life, with rare serious complications.

Objective: To evaluate the influence of preoperative fasting duration on blood volume status of pediatric patients during induction based on ultrasonic technique. Methods: One hundred and ten pediatric patients, scheduled for elective operation in the Second Affiliated Hospital & Yuying Children's Hospital, were recruited during January and October in 2018. After sedation by inhalation of sevoflurane, the maximum (expiratory) and minimum (inspiratory) diameter of inferior vena cava (IVC(max), IVC(min)) and aorta velocity-time integral (VTI) in apical five-chamber cardiac view were measured with an ultrasound machine. Respiratory variabilities of these parameters were further calculated. Furthermore, passive leg raising (PLR) test was performed and above measurements/calculations were repeated. The correlation between the duration of fasting and IVC respiratory variations index (IVC(RVI)) or aortic VTI variability (ΔVTI) was then analyzed. Results: Before PLR, IVC(max), IVC(min) and IVC(RVI) were (0.78±0.19), (0.43±0.15) cm and 0.45±0.12, respectively. After PLR, IVC(max) and IVC(min) increased to (0.94±0.20), (0.55±0.18) cm, while IVC(RVI) decreased to 0.42±0.13, the differences were statistically significant (t=15.66, 10.85, 3.14, all P<0.05). However, IVC(max), IVC(min) and IVC(RVI) were not significantly correlated with the duration of fasting analyzed by linear regression (before PLR: r=0.052, 0.163, 0.171; after PLR, r=0.062, 0.169, 0.165, all P>0.05). Before PLR, expiratory aortic VTI (VTI(max)), inspiratory aortic VTI (VTI(min)) and ΔVTI were 21±5, 17±4 and 17±8, respectively. After PLR, the VTI(max) and VTI(min) significantly increased to 23±5 and 19±4 (t=13.60, 10.43, all P<0.05), but ΔVTI was not changed significantly, which was 17±8(t=0.34, P>0.05). Linear regression analysis showed that VTI(max), VTI(min) and ΔVTI were not significantly correlated with the duration of fasting (before PLR: r=0.111, 0.100, 0.047; after PLR: r=0.003, 0.033, 0.073, all P>0.05). Further multiple linear regression analysis indicated that, age and body weight were independent factors influencing IVC(RVI) and ΔVTI before and after PLR (IVC(RVI): ß=-0.441, 0.515, -0.451, 0.507; ΔVTI: ß=-0.442, 0.545, -2.422, 2.850; all P<0.05). However, the duration of fasting was not correlated with IVC(RVI) and ΔVTI after adjusting the age and weight (IVC(RVI): ß=0.177, 0.160; ΔVTI: ß=0.037, 0.054; all P>0.05). Conclusion: Age and weight, but not preoperative fasting duration, are correlated with respiratory variabilities of inferior vena cava diameter and aortic VTI in pediatric patients.

Objective: We aimed to explore the feasibility and perioperative safety of performing catheter ablation and left atrial appendage closure (LAAC) in a single (one-stop) session in patients with atrial fibrillation (AF). Methods: This study is an observational study. Consecutive AF patients who underwent the combined procedure of catheter ablation and LAAC with Watchman device of Xinhua Hospital in Shanghai between March 2017 and May 2019 were prospectively enrolled. Baseline, intra-and peri-procedural parameters were evaluated. Results: A total of 358 AF patients (189 males, (69.0±8.0) years) underwent the one-stop procedure. The CHA2DS2-VASc score was 3.2±1.5 and HAS-BLED score was 2.4±1.1, respectively in this patient cohort. Pulmonary vein isolation was achieved in all patients, while additional linear ablation was applied in 180 (50.3%) patients, yielding immediate success rate of 99.7%. Successful Watchman implantation was achieved in all patients. The perioperative serious adverse event occurred in 14 cases (3.9%). including 6 pericardial effusions (1.7%), 1 stroke (0.3%) and 5 vascular complications (1.4%), yielding procedure-related complication rate of 3.4%. In addition, 2 (0.6%) new-onset heart failures occurred postoperatively. There was no major bleeding or death during the perioperative period. Conclusions: Combined catheter ablation and LAAC can be successfully and safely performed in AF patients with high stroke risk. Follow-up data are needed to evaluate the outcome of this one-stop procedure.

In recent years, mesh structures have attracted significant interest for structural and functional applications. However, the mechanical strength and energy absorption ability of uniform mesh structured materials degrade with density. To address this challenge, we propose the concept of functionally graded mesh structures. The objective of the proposed research is to fundamentally understand the compressive behavior of graded mesh structures. The compression-compression fatigue behavior of functionally graded Ti-6Al-4V mesh structure under identical bulk stress condition is studied here. During cyclic deformation, it was observed that the local stress distribution in the struts was not uniform because of inhomogeneous mechanical properties of the constituents. Fatigue cracks first initiated in the lowest strength constituent, and then propagated until structural failure occurred. However, no obvious damage was observed in other constituents during the entire process. In contrast with iso-strain state, the fatigue life of graded structure is mainly determined by the constituent with the lowest strength.

During an environmental assessment on the Huang River in Xinyang City (Henan Province, China), a novel Myxobolus species (Myxozoa: Myxobolidae) was found infecting the trunk muscle of Chinese false gudgeon Abbottina rivularis Basilewsky, 1855 (Gobioninae, Cyprinidae). Plasmodia of the new myxozoan, nominated herein as Myxobolus xinyangensis sp. nov., are round and yellowish, symmetrically and bilaterally located dorsal to the openings of the 2 opercula, and measure about 4.5 mm in diameter. The mature myxospores are orbicular in frontal view and fusiform in sutural view, with slightly tapered anterior end and rounded posterior end, and measure 9.4 ± 0.5 (8.7-10.6) µm long, 8.6 ± 0.6 (7.3-9.5) µm wide and 6.4 ± 0.3 (5.8-7.1) µm thick (mean ± SD, range). The ratio of spore length to spore width is close to 1. Two slightly unequal pyriform polar capsules, with tapering anterior ends and rounded posterior ends, measure 5.6 ± 0.67 (4.3-6.8) µm long and 3.0 ± 0.3 (2.4-3.6) µm wide, present as a figure 8 in the anterior part of spores and tightly converge at the top end of spores. Polar filament coils show 4 to 5 turns and are situated perpendicularly to the longitudinal axis of the polar capsules. No intercapsular appendix or sutural folds at the posterior end of spores were observed. The obtained partial small subunit ribosomal DNA sequence did not match any available data in GenBank and showed the highest sequence identity (93%) with 2 cyprinid trunk muscle-infecting Myxobolus species, M. pseudodispar and M. klamathellus. Phylogenetic analysis clearly showed that M. xinyangensis sp. nov. clustered within a cyprinid trunk muscle-infecting Myxobolus subclade at the basal position, but as an independent branch which was a possible reflection of its distinct myxospore morphology. This is the first record of infection of Myxobolus species in the trunk muscle of Abbotina fish.

Objective: To analyze the survival time of people living with HIV/AIDS and related influencing factors in Sichuan province during 1991-2017. Methods: A retrospective cohort study was conducted to analyze the data of 143 988 HIV/AIDS cases. The data were collected from Chinese HIV/AIDS Comprehensive Information Management System. Life table method was used to calculate the survival proportion of the cases, and Cox proportion hazard regression model was used to identify the factors related with survival time. Results: Among 143 988 HIV/AIDS cases a total of 30 420 cases died of AIDS related diseases (21.1%) and the average survival time was 11.51 years (95%CI: 11.39-11.64). Multivariate Cox regression analysis showed that the influencing factors for the survival of HIV/AIDS cases were gender (male vs. female, HR=1.35, 95%CI: 1.32-1.40), education level (primary school or below vs. junior middle school: HR=1.15, 95%CI: 1.12-1.18), ethnic group (Han vs. other ethnic groups, HR=1.46, 95%CI: 1.41-1.52), occupation (farmer vs. other occupations: HR=1.26, 95%CI: 1.22-1.29), age (≥55 years old vs. 15-24 years old: HR=3.18, 95%CI: 3.02- 3.36), disease phase (AIDS vs. HIV infection: HR=1.44, 95%CI: 1.39-1.48), antiretroviral therapy (ART) (receiving ART vs. receiving no ART: HR=0.20, 95%CI: 0.19-0.20), and CD(4)(+)T cell counts at diagnosis (>500 cells/µl vs.<200 cells/µl: HR=0.42, 95%CI: 0.40-0.45). Conclusions: The average survival time of HIV/AIDS cases was 11.51 years in Sichuan during 1991- 2017. The risk factors for the survival of the cases were male, education level of primary school or below, Han ethnic group, farmer, old age at diagnosis, disease phase, The protective factors for the survival of HIV/AIDS cases were receiving ART and higher CD(4)(+) T cell counts at diagnosis.

Objective: To evaluate clinical outcomes of autologous and allogeneic peripheral blood stem cell transplantation (PBSCT) for aggressive peripheral T-cell lymphoma (PTCL). Methods: From June 2007 to June 2017, clinical data of PTCL patients who underwent PBSCT were assessed retrospectively. Results: Among 41 patients, 30 was male, 11 female, and median age was 38(13-57) years old. Seventeen patients with autologous PBSCT (auto-PBSCT) and 24 patients with allogeneic PBSCT (allo-PBSCT) were enrolled in this study. Eight patients (8/17, 47.1%) in auto-PBSCT group were ALK positive anaplastic large cell lymphoma (ALCL), 7 patients (7/24, 29.2%) with NK/T cell lymphoma and 9 patients (9/24, 37.5%) with PTCL-unspecified (PTCL-U) in allo-PBSCT group (P=0.035). There were 58.8% patients (10/17) in complete response (CR) status and 11.8% (2/17) in progression disease (PD) status before transplantation in auto-PBSCT group, and 8.3% (2/24) in CR status and 45.8% (11/24) in PD status before transplantation in allo-PBSCT group (P=0.026). The 2-years cumulative overall survival (OS) were (64.0±10.8)% and (53.5±9.7)% for auto-PBSCT and allo-PBSCT respectively (P=0.543). The 2-years cumulative disease-free survival (DFS) were (57.1±12.4)% and (53.5±10.6)% for auto-PBSCT and allo-PBSCT respectively (P=0.701). In patients with dead outcomes after PBSCT, 83.3% (5/6) of death cause was relapse in auto-PBSCT and 41.7% (5/12) of death cause was relapse in allo-PBSCT. Conclusion: Both auto-PBSCT and allo-PBSCT were effective for PTCL. Allo-PBSCT maybe was better than auto-PBSCT for high-risk PTCL with poor prognosis.

Objective: To develop and prospectively validate a risk score for acute chest pain patients with normal high-sensitivity troponin I (hs-TnI) levels and without obvious ST-segment deviation in China. Methods: Chest pain patients admitted to the emergency department of Beijing Anzhen Hospital from September 2014 to July 2015 were enrolled. Baseline characteristics of patients met inclusion criteria including normal hs-TnI levels and without obvious ST-segment deviation were included. The endpoint (major adverse cardiovascular events) was a composite of acute myocardial infarction, percutaneous coronary intervention, coronary artery bypass graft, and all-cause death within 3 months after initial presentation. Predictors were screened and used to develop the risk score model by logistic regression analysis in a retrospective cohort. Then, the risk score model was evaluated in a prospective validation cohort. Results: The study population of derivation cohort included 1 735 consecutive chest pain patients. Finally, 1 030 eligible patients were enrolled. Multivariate regression analysis defined five independent predictors: male gender (ß=0.88); history of chest pain (ß value of moderate and high suspicion of coronary heart artery was 2.70 and 3.51 respectively); electrocardiogram (ß=0.84); ≥60 years old (ß=0.51) and ≥3 risk factors (ß=0.85).The range of weighted score was set as 0-13. The area under a receiver operating characteristic (ROC) curve was 0.75 (95%CI 0.72-0.78) in the final model. Major adverse cardiovascular events rates increased in proportion to score increase (P<0.01). The internal validity used bootstrap technique showed the same predictor factors as the final model, and its area under a ROC curve was 0.75(95%CI 0.72-0.78).MACE rates in the low risk group (score 0-3), intermediate risk group (score 4-7), and high risk group (score 8-13) were 1.3% (1/77) ,19.0% (22/116) ,and 42.2% (122/289) in the prospective validation cohort, respectively (P<0.01). Conclusion: The developed ischemic risk score is feasible for risk stratification of acute chest pain patients with normal hs-TnI and without obvious ST-segment deviation, this score might be helpful to the decision making of treatment and management strategies for these patients.

BACKGROUND AND AIMS: Dyslipidemia predicts higher risk of coronary events and stroke and might be associated with cerebral small vessel disease (SVD). Previous studies linking blood lipids and SVD have yielded inconsistent results, which may be attributable to sex differences in lipids metabolism. The aim of this study was to investigate the relationships between blood lipids and SVD in neurologically healthy men and women. METHODS AND RESULTS: Consecutive 817 people aged 50 years or more were enrolled and underwent magnetic resonance imaging scans to evaluate the periventricular white matter lesions (PVWMLs), deep white matter lesions (DWMLs) and silent brain infarction (SBI). Fasting total cholesterol, triglyceride, high density lipoprotein cholesterol (HDL-C), low density lipoprotein cholesterol, apolipoprotein A-1 (apoA-1) and apolipoprotein B were assessed. Multivariable logistic regression analyses were performed to determine the associations of blood lipids with PVWMLs, DWMLs and SBI. HDL-C (for PVWMLs: OR 0.36, 95% CI 0.19-0.71; for DWMLs: OR 0.35, 95% CI 0.20-0.63) and apoA-1 (for PVWMLs: OR 0.27, 95% CI 0.11-0.66; for DWMLs: OR 0.22, 95% CI 0.10-0.48) were inversely associated with the severity of PVWMLs and DWMLs in women but not in men after adjustment for age, hypertension, diabetes, current smoking, daily drinking, body mass index and uric acid. Additionally, no blood lipids were significantly associated with SBI. CONCLUSIONS: Our findings demonstrate that sex differences may exist in the associations between lipids and SVD. HDL-C and apoA-1 levels were inversely associated with the severity of PVWMLs and DWMLs in women.

Objective: To explore whether diabetes mellitus (DM) impairs functions of bone marrow-derived endothelial progenitor cells (BM-EPC) and circulating EPC. Methods: Diabetic model of rabbit was induced by Alloxan injection and the rabbits were then randomly divided into three groups: BM-EPC group, circulating EPC group, and DM group, with six rabbits in each group. Another 6 normal rabbits were enrolled as normal control group as well. 8 weeks later, BM-EPC and circulating EPC from diabetic and healthy rabbits were isolated and cultured. Colony number, proliferation, adhesion and tube formation function were detected. Exogenous diabetic BM-EPC and circulating EPC were analyzed for therapeutic efficacy in acute ischemia model of diabetic rabbits. Left ventricular (LV) function was assessed using Echocardiography. Capillary density and fibrosis area were evaluated by confocal laser scanning microscope (CLSM) and Masson-trichrome staining. The mRNA expression of vascular endothelial growth factor (VEGF) and basic fibroblast growth factor (bFGF) was analyzed using real-time quantitive PCR. Results: Colony number, proliferation, adhesion and tube formation function of diabetic circulating EPC were significantly reduced compared with healthy rabbits. DM impaired tube-forming ability of BM-EPC, but did not influence colony number, proliferation and adhesion function. Compared with circulating EPC and control group, BM-EPC group had fewer fibrosis area (6.98%±0.94% vs 13.03%±2.97% and 15.84%±4.74%, both P=0.001), higher capillary density [(792±87) vs (528±71) and (372±77) vessels/mm(2,) both P<0.001], higher mRNA expression of VEGF (6.25±2.33 vs 2.19±1.01 and 1.55±0.52, both P<0.001) and bFGF (6.38±2.65 vs 1.24±0.76 and 1.18±0.82, both P<0.001), higher left ventricular ejection fraction (LVEF) (61%±4% vs 47%±5% and 50%±10%, both P<0.05). Conclusions: DM not only impaired functions of circulating EPC, but also influenced tube formation function of BM-EPC. Auto transplantation of BM-EPC may rescue the ischemic myocardium by neovascularization and paracrine effect in diabetic rabbits.

FeSe exhibits a novel ground state in which superconductivity coexists with a nematic order in the absence of any long-range magnetic order. Here, we report on an angle-resolved photoemission study on the superconducting gap structure in the nematic state of FeSe_{0.93}S_{0.07}, without the complications caused by Fermi surface reconstruction induced by magnetic order. We find that the superconducting gap shows a pronounced twofold anisotropy around the elliptical hole pocket near Z (0, 0, π), with gap minima at the end points of its major axis, while no detectable gap is observed around Γ (0, 0, 0) and the zone corner (π, π, k_{z}). The large anisotropy and nodal gap distribution demonstrate the substantial effects of the nematicity on the superconductivity and thus put strong constraints on current theories.

Objective: To explore the efficacy of laparoscopic surgery in treatment of advanced mid-low rectal cancer following a long-term neoadjuvant chemoradiotherapy. Methods: Clinicopathologic and perioperative data were collected retrospectively from 74 patients with advanced mid-low rectal cancer, who received both neoadjuvant chemoradiotherapy and resections between January 2010 and January 2013 at Xinjiang tumor hospital. Routine follow-up was conducted. The safety and long-term survival of 36 patients who underwent laparoscopic resection were compared with those of 38 patients who received conventional resection. Results: The laparoscopic group had less amount of blood loss during surgery (50 ml vs 100 ml, P<0.05). The time needed for recovery of gastrointestinal function in the laparoscopic group was significantly shorter than that in the open surgery group (2.0 d vs 3.0 d, P<0.05). The rate of postoperative complication was 19.4% and 42.1% (P<0.05), respectively. In terms of the range of radical surgery and the numbers of dissected lymph nodes (8 and 10, P>0.05), no significant difference were found in the two groups. The operation duration and hospital stay in the laparoscopic group was longer than that in the open surgery group (240.0 min vs 231.5 min , P>0.05) (22.0 d vs 21.5 d , P>0.05), but no significant difference was found between the two groups. There were no significant difference in the incidence of 3 disease-free survival rate (53.0% vs 43.8%, P>0.05) and overall survival rate (70.0% vs 62.9%, P>0.05) between two groups. Conclusion: Laparoscopic surgery is a safe and feasible option for advanced mid-low rectal cancer patients who undergone the neoadjuvant chemoradiotherapy because of the similar rate of radical resection and satisfied long-term outcomes, which will have a better prospect in the future.

We investigated the associations between Beclin-1 and microRNA-30a (miR-30a) expression and the severity and treatment response in colorectal cancer (CRC). Our sample size consisted of 139 CRC patients who were treated with surgery alone. Immunohistochemistry was used to investigate the expression and prognostic significance of Beclin-1 in CRC, while the weak expression of Beclin-1 in normal tissue was used as the basis for assessing tumors (control group). Real-time reverse transcription-polymerase chain reaction quantified miR-30a levels. The expression levels of Beclin-1 and miR-30a were associated with clinical variables and prognoses. Beclin-1 was expressed more highly in CRC tissues than in controls. This expression was related to gender (P = 0.023), histological grade (P = 0.006), M stage (P = 0.004), tumor node metastasis stage (P = 0.020), vascular invasion, and nodal involvement. Patients with higher Beclin-1 expression levels had higher survival rates (P = 0.08) than patients with lower Beclin-1 expression levels. Beclin-1 was a prognostic indicator (P < 0.05) in a multivariate analysis. Beclin-1 was overexpressed in CRC tissues and was correlated with lower levels of miR-30a (P < 0.05, r = -0. 4189). In conclusion, Beclin-1 was a good prognostic indicator in CRC and was correlated with survival rate. Beclin-1 is important in the growth and metastasis of CRC. Apoptosis in CRC might be due to the increased autophagy induced by decreased levels of miR-30a.

As an essential trace element, copper can be toxic in mammalian cells when present in excess. Metallothioneins (MTs) are small, cysteine-rich proteins that avidly bind copper and thus play an important role in detoxification. Yeast CUP1 is a member of the MT gene family. The aim of this study was to determine whether yeast CUP1 could bind copper effectively and protect cells against copper stress. In this study, CUP1 expression was determined by quantitative real-time PCR, and copper content was detected by inductively coupled plasma mass spectrometry. Production of intracellular reactive oxygen species (ROS) was evaluated using the 2',7'-dichlorofluorescein-diacetate (DCFH-DA) assay. Cellular viability was detected using the 3-(4,5-dimethylthiazol-2-yl)-2,5-diphenyltetrazolium bromide assay, and the cell cycle distribution of CUP1 was analyzed by fluorescence-activated cell sorting. The data indicated that overexpression of yeast CUP1 in HeLa cells played a protective role against copper-induced stress, leading to increased cellular viability (P<0.05) and decreased ROS production (P<0.05). It was also observed that overexpression of yeast CUP1 reduced the percentage of G1 cells and increased the percentage of S cells, which suggested that it contributed to cell viability. We found that overexpression of yeast CUP1 protected HeLa cells against copper stress. These results offer useful data to elucidate the mechanism of the MT gene on copper metabolism in mammalian cells.

BACKGROUND: Little is known about the occurrence of transfusion-related acute lung injury(TRALI) in Chinese paediatric patients. As such, a retrospective review of medical records from January 2008 to December 2011 was undertaken. OBJECTIVE: To determine the incidence of TRALI and its risk factors in children (age <14 years). STUDY DESIGN AND METHODS: All medical records of Sheng Jing Hospital from January 2008 to December 2011 were reviewed retrospectively using the hospital's record system. Paediatric surgical patients who had been diagnosed clinically with acute lung injury were included. Transfusion data were collected, together with risk factors such as sepsis and aspiration. RESULTS: In total, 1495 patients were involved in the study. Thirty-five cases were analysed further as they had acute lung injury, pulmonary oedema and respiratory distress. TRALI was confirmed in two of these cases. The average duration of transfusion was found to be significantly longer in patients with TRALI compared with controls, and the percentage of female donors was significantly higher for patients with TRALI. CONCLUSION: The incidence of TRALI was found to be lower than reported previously, but TRALI is under-recognised, under-reported and undertreated.
